SDLC methodologies and models
« Reply #16 on: April 03, 2018, 12:21:12 PM »
Here we discuss on the topics of Software development life cycle(SDLC)
METHODOLOGIES     MODELS
Sequential               Waterfall
Iterative                  Rational unified process
Evolutionary            Spiral
Agile                       Scrum


SEQUENTIAL-WATERFALL:- Waterfall model is Very simple and easy to understand and use it is also referred as a linear sequential life cycle. It is suitable for shot term projects maximum of 1 year projects. In waterfall model until one phase of the project is entirely complete we can not start another one. once a single phase is fully complete they examine is the part is correct or need any other changes if no changes needed then we can process further.

ITERATIVE-RATIONAL UNIFIED PROCESS:-It is mainly focused on the main building blocks or content elements, describing what is to be produced , the necessary skills required to achieve a specific goals.
In iterative methodologies we use 6 ENGINEERING DISCIPLINES(Business modelling, requirements,analysis and design,implementation,test,deployment)AND 3 SUPPORTING DISCIPLINES (Configuration&change request, project management, and deployment)which are having there impact on the Different phased of project life cycle as INCEPTION, ELABORATION, CONSTRUCTION AND TRANSITIONS
 
EVOLUTIONARY-SPIRAL:-In evolutionary Methodologies we first prepare a prototyping of the project and then start working on it and it is one of the costly method for preparing project because it takes a lot of paper work as well.It suits for the scientific project much more.They design prototype and then come to implement part of the project.It is more preferred for long duration projects.

AGILE-SCRUM:-Agile is one of the Modern Method of the methodologies used in nowadays.In Scrum we prepare a syntax according to clients requirements and the collections of all the EPIC we continue a Backlog.By using syntax like AS A_,I WANT_,SO THAT_. and GIVEN_,WHEN_,THEN_. we create user stories where collection of all user stories wee prepare PRODUCT BACKLOG, out of them we take some selected user stories and prepare SPRINT BACKLOG, then out of them we pick selected user stories and prepare RELEASE BACKLOG.

this are the main SDLC we come to know and every company have the method according to there project.

Rather than list tools, which vary with companies and sometimes teams, let me list the tool categories that are typically used by BAs:

Documentation: MS Word. Knowing how to use Word is not an end in itself but a means to various ends; what really matters is to put Word to effective use for the unique, specific purposes of your project.
Presentation: MS Powerpoint. Similar rules as above.
Data Analysis: MS Excel, SQL querying.
Modeling, Flowcharts: MS Visio, eDraw.
Wireframing, Mockups: Pencil, Balsamiq, MS Visio.
Communication, Collaboration: A good understanding of how to “effectively” use email, chat, phone, audio and video conferencing, web meeting, shared network/cloud storage systems, SVN.

GANTT Chart:

Gantt chart is a kind of bar chart that used for development of project schedule.

Gantt charts are used for planning and scheduling in projects.

Gantt charts are used is most of the projects
Example: Software development, construction, Planning of a architecture.

If the project is small and simple in nature, we can create our own Gantt chart in Excel.

Using Gantt chart is easy, but it would become complex when the project is involved in hundreds of activities.

Gannt chart is considered as the most important project management tool used for showing the phases, tasks, milestones and resources needed as part of a project.


R:
A programming language and a software environment for statistical computing and graphics

R language is an open source (anybody can access) tool and user-friendly tool.

R is object-oriented language

There are many GUI available can sit on R and enhance its user friendliness.


Microsoft Visio:

The application mainly designed for communication purpose

Visio can also be used for Capturing and presenting ideas to stake holders.

We can use Visio for designing flow charts, creating data models

Visio is used for preparing UML diagrams use case and activity diagrams.

Through Visio we can prepare Software& Database, Network, Business diagrams

Microsoft word:
Requirements specification documents can be prepared using Microsoft word.

There are many templates included in the Microsoft word that can be used for documenting requirements and also we can create our own templates.

Microsoft word provided various features to use for example the application allows us to set various fonts, apply themes

Microsoft word allows to embed external objects like Excel work sheets

Microsoft Excel:

Data analysis is effectively supported through Microsoft Excel.

We can create pivot tables to examine the trends in data, sort and filter data

Excel is made to support to create tables, charts or graphs

Excel supports many mathematical functions that would help in most parts and types of analysis.

Microsoft Power Point:

M Power point is used for capturing, designing and represented as presentation with the help of slides

Power point supports text, graphics and multimedia to support a presentation.
Microsoft PowerPoint support various features that can be used/included for developing beautiful and professional presentations.

Google Docs:

Google Docs is used for sharing non- confidential information

Google Docs allows to chat and collaborate with stake holders involved in the project.

There are many tools available that can be used by a Business Analyst, but the main and most frequently used are:
1) JIRA                     :This tool is used for project management.
2) M.S Visio              : This tool is used to draw Flow Charts ad UML diagrams- Use Case Diagrams and Activity Diagrams.
3) Balsamiq              : It is a tool that is static, used for mock-ups and presentation in documentation.
4) Axure                   :It is a tool that is dynamic, used to show the look and feel of a working model in a presentation as a prototype.
5) Power BI              : It is a business analytics service reporting tool.
6) Tableau                : It is a reporting tool.
7) SSRS                   : It is a reporting tool.
8 ) SQL                    : SQL is a domain-specific language used in programming and designed for managing data held in a RDBMS.
9)MS Word               : It is used for documentation purposes.
10) MS Powerpoint    : It is a tool that is used for presentation.
